| | 3-Bromobenzaldehyde Usage And Synthesis |
| Chemical Properties | clear colorless to yellow liquid after melting | | Uses | A substituted benzaldehyde used in the synthesis of more complex pharmaceutical compounds. It is also employed as an active pharmaceutical ingredient. | | Uses | 3-Bromobenzaldehyde, is a substituted benzaldehyde, shown to have antibacterial activity against Mycobacterium tuberculosis. It is also a versatile building block, used in the synthesis of more complex pharmaceutical compounds. |
